Germany Rail Pass

Conditions

  • Residents of Europe, the United Kingdom, Turkey, Morocco, Algeria, Tunisia and the Russian Federation are not eligible to purchase or use a German Rail Pass.
  • Passes must be validated within 6 months of issuing date by a railway official in Germany
  • Passes must be validated prior to boarding the first train/ first use of travel bonus.
  • All parties must be present when validating the pass.
  • 7:00pm rule: if a direct overnight train starts after 7:00pm on a validated German Rail Pass, the passholder must enter the next day's date on the pass, provided it falls within the validity of the pass.
  • Seat reservation fees are an additional charge and not inclusive in the cost of the pass.
  • Comprehensive conditions of use can be found on the ticket cover.

Refunds

  • German Rail Passes must be presented for refund unused and not validated.
  • A 25% cancellation fee plus GST (only in Australia) applies to totally unused passes returned within 1 year of issuing date.
  • No partial refunds.
  • German Rail Passes cannot be refunded or reissued if lost or stolen.
